Role of cholesterol in ligand binding and G-protein coupling of serotonin1A receptors solubilized from bovine hippocampus.

Amitabha Chattopadhyay1, Md Jafurulla, Shanti Kalipatnapu, Thomas J Pucadyil, Kaleeckal G Harikumar.   

Abstract

The serotonin(1A) (5-HT(1A)) receptor is an important member of the superfamily of seven transmembrane domain G-protein-coupled receptors. We report here that solubilization of the hippocampal 5-HT(1A) receptor by the zwitterionic detergent CHAPS is accompanied by loss of membrane cholesterol which results in a reduction in specific agonist binding activity and extent of G-protein coupling. Importantly, replenishment of cholesterol to solubilized membranes using MbetaCD-cholesterol complex restores the cholesterol content of the membrane and significantly enhances the specific agonist binding activity and G-protein coupling. These novel results provide useful information on the role of cholesterol in solubilization of G-protein-coupled receptors, an important step for molecular characterization of these receptors.
